| ## dns-01 vs http-01 |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| For `type` http-01: |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
|     // `altname` is the name of the domain |  | ||||||
|     // `token` is the name of the file ( .well-known/acme-challenge/`token` ) |  | ||||||
|     // `keyAuthorization` is the contents of the file |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| For `type` dns-01: |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
|     // `dnsHost` is the domain/subdomain/host |  | ||||||
|     // `dnsAuthorization` is the value of the TXT record |  | ||||||

| ### Two notes: |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| Note 1: |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| The `API.get()`, `API.set()`, and `API.remove()` is where you do your magic up to upload a file to the correct |  | ||||||
| location on an http serever, set DNS records, or add the appropriate data to the database that handles such things. |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| Note 2: |  | ||||||
| 
 |  | ||||||
| - When `altname` is `foo.example.com` the `dnsHost` will be `_acme-challenge.foo.example.com` |  | ||||||
| - When `altname` is `*.foo.example.com` the `dnsHost` will _still_ be `_acme-challenge.foo.example.com`!! |  | ||||||
| - When `altname` is `bar.foo.example.com` the `dnsHost` will be `_acme-challenge.bar.foo.example.com` |  | ||||||
